WebApr 1, 2024 · Keyboard Shortcut. To activate spell-check on your worksheet, the user can directly press F7 (keyboard shortcut). Create an Excel sheet and select the cell or range of cells and press the keyboard key F7 or for some systems where F7 has been allotted different task press fn (function) key along with F7. However, it must be noted that we may first need to activate the function keys by pressing the 'Fn' button on ... thinkrichstore 広島県WebPlease do as follows to spell check all sheets or entire workbook at once in Excel. 1. Right click on any sheet tab in the workbook you need to spell check, then click Select All Sheets from the context menu. See screenshot: 2. Now all sheets in the current workbook are selected.
